What insight can geography provide regarding the unity and division that pervades the contemporary world?

The international division of labor - specialization of individual countries in the production of certain products.The international division of labor based on the differences between the countries in the natural and climatic conditions, geographical location, natural resources and energy sources.At the same time the world united in a single trade and economic system that allows you to share the most products with each other.

A Physical characteristic is the one that is due the natural formation of Earth and the different climatological changes like storms, Earthquakes, etc. The humankind don´t make it, is product of nature.

A human characteristic, is when the organization trough different cultures and trough the different civilizations settle different governments, industries, etc.

Streams, any running water from a creek to a furious waterway, complete the hydrologic cycle by returning precipitation that falls ashore to the seas. A portion of this water moves over the surface, and a few travel through the ground as groundwater. Streaming water takes every necessary step of both disintegration and testimony.

Streams with a high angle have a quicker speed and more noteworthy competence. Particles that are too huge even to consider being conveyed as suspended burdens are knocked and pushed along the stream bed, called bed load.
